**Mgmt Meeting Minutes — Retiring the Brightline Range**

Quick recap for sales leads at Fenholt Supplies: we agreed to retire the Brightline fixture range by year-end. Remaining stock moves to clearance pricing next month, and accounts on standing orders get migrated to the Lumetta range. Trade-in incentives were approved in principle. The confidential note on next steps sits just below.

board note of bajof-bajeg: The pricing group signed off on a budget of $13.4 million for Project Sildor. The renewal with Lamixek Holdings closes at $48.9 million a year, 49 percent above the last contract.

Sales leads: do not reference Bramfield in any customer conversation. Pipeline deals touching their territory go to Marta Quill for review before quoting. Discounting in the Northvale region is frozen until further notice.

Expect a full enablement pack two weeks after signing. Questions go through your regional director only.

The note below covers the integration plan and must not leave this group.

board note of bawep-tajef: Queniusek Systems plans to raise the Quenvan list price by 53.1 percent in March. The pricing group signed off on a budget of $176.4 million for Project Drueth. The renewal with Casionix Partners closes at $142.5 million a year, 8.3 percent below the last contract. Project Fraax slips by six weeks because of the tooling delay.

Quarterly Planning Note — JV Proposal

Heads of department: the proposed joint venture between Harnfield Optics and Belltower Instruments moves to term-sheet stage this quarter. Each side contributes lab capacity; Harnfield leads product, Belltower leads distribution in the Merrow region. Budget holders should reserve integration hours in Q4 plans. Questions route through the planning office. The confidential business-plan note is appended below.

confidential, fafog-fafog: Only 21 of the 82 pilot accounts renewed Holwyn, so a churn review is set for September 1. Normirox Logistics is in early talks to buy Praiusox Foods for about $134.2 million.

**Vendor note: Inkmill markdown pipeline**

Rendering for Parchway docs is outsourced to Inkmill under an annual contract, renewing each March. They handle sanitization and PDF export; we own the upload queue. SLA: 4-hour response on rendering failures. Escalate only after two failed retries. Their support desk is reachable at the address below.

billing contact of hahaf-baguf = zorael.tammir.jorius@sivrelhq.internal